Re: how to concatenate fields?

2005-03-07 14:00:28
Tiffany Blake wrote:
does this look correct?

Not quite.

> <xsl:if test="string-length(location)&gt;0">
>    <p><b><xsl:value-of select="location"/></b>" - "
                                                        ^
The linefeed  and the space used for indentation on the next line
will appear in the output and produce a visible space in the browser.
The quotes will also appear in the output.
You should use xsl:text here (see below)

>    <xsl:value-of select="publish_date"/>" - "</p>
The </p> end tag will end the block, i.e. you are getting
a new line in the browser.

Try
  <p>
    <xsl:if test="string-length(location)&gt;0">
      <b><xsl:value-of select="location"/></b>
      <xsl:text>-</xsl:text>
      <xsl:value-of select="publish_date"/>
      <xsl:text>-</xsl:text>
    </xsl:if>
    <xsl:if test="string-length(/gapinc/body_text)&gt;0">
      <xsl:apply-templates select="/gapinc/body_text"/>
    </xsl:if>
  </p>
